Health & Physical Education at Caldwell University
If you plan to study health and physical education, take a look at what Caldwell University has to offer and decide if the program is a good match for you. Get started with the following essential facts.Caldwell is located in Caldwell, New Jersey and has a total student population of 2,274. In 2021, 9 phys ed majors received their bachelor's degree from Caldwell.

Careers That Phys Ed Grads May Go Into
A degree in phys ed can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for NJ, the home state for Caldwell University.
Occupation | Jobs in NJ | Average Salary in NJ |
---|---|---|
Fitness Trainers and Aerobics Instructors | 11,310 | $54,200 |
Coaches and Scouts | 8,720 | $51,290 |
Athletic Trainers | 880 | $51,890 |
Recreation and Fitness Studies Professors | 260 | $70,760 |
Exercise Physiologists | 130 | $51,280 |
